George Zimmerman to Be Charged in the Death of Trayvon Martin

0

The Trayvon Martin shooting will finally head for a courtroom now that
Florida special prosecutor Angela Corey has decided to charge George
Zimmerman in the February 26th shooting of Trayvon Martin. The Washington Post’s Sari Horwitz reports
that Corey will hold a press conference to announce the charges, but so
far none are known.

NBC News and other outlets are reporting that the conference will be held tonight at 6pm EST. Associated Press’ Kyle Hightower and Brendan Farrington didn’t
have much to add, but they spoke to a law enforcement official “with
knowledge of the investigation,” who confirmed that the charges would be
announced this evening. Both reports tiptoed around the topic of police
tracking down Zimmerman to arrest him when the time comes, a task that
seems more and more daunting by the day. 

Miami Herald reporter Frances Robles tweets
that Zimmerman will face only one charge. So far, Zimmerman has not
been charged in Sanford, Florida, where the crime took place because of
the state’s “stand your ground” law.
